Просмотр исходного кода

Choose a thumbnail from the photos of the post without thumbnail and banner

Signed-off-by: Xiaofeng QU <xiaofeng.qu.hk@ieee.org>
Xiaofeng QU 10 лет назад
Родитель
Сommit
9ca2ed1133
1 измененных файлов с 4 добавлено и 2 удалено
  1. 4 2
      layout/_partial/post/thumbnail.ejs

+ 4 - 2
layout/_partial/post/thumbnail.ejs

@@ -1,14 +1,16 @@
 <a href="<%- url_for((post.link?post.link:post.path)) %>" class="thumbnail">
   <%
     var s = "";
-    
+
     if (post.thumbnail){
       s = post.thumbnail;
     }else if (post.banner){
       s = post.banner;
+    }else if (post.photos && post.photos.length){
+      s = post.photos[0];
     }else{
       var img=/\<img\s.*?\s?src\s*=\s*['|"]?([^\s'"]+).*?\>/ig;
-      var result = post.content.match(img);  
+      var result = post.content.match(img);
       result = img.exec(post.content);
       if(result != null) {
         for(var i = result.length -1; i; --i){